Love those K springs!

I got them installed thursday night, and took the car up to Silver Springs for the 14th Annual Mustang Round up on Sat. We average 80 and up to 100 a few times. The handling was solid and not springy. We took a few big cures and it was nice.

The over all ride quality is excellent. It's firmer than OEM, and even stiffer when you throw it in to the corners. I have the GT oem struts and springs. I'll upgrade those early next year.

I have 20" deep dish Bullit's and the difference between the top on the tire and the bottom edge of the fender lip is just over 1 inch in both front and back.
